Overview

The HPC Laser LS1390 is an IPG Fiber Laser cutting machine designed for engraving and cutting signs, metal panels, and similar materials. It is a professional-grade system intended for use by trained and skilled personnel.

Function Description

The LS1390 operates as a laser cutter, utilizing an IPG Fiber Laser to precisely engrave and cut various metal substrates. The machine is equipped with an automatic height control system and a professional on-board computer control system, which manages the cutting process. The laser system emits intensive and invisible Class 4 laser radiation, requiring strict adherence to safety precautions during operation. The machine's core function involves directing a high-power laser beam onto the material to achieve precise cuts and engravings. It is designed for continuous operation, with a working time of 24 hours, and includes a chiller unit and fan system for cooling, along with an exhaust pipe to manage fumes and debris. The machine is housed in a fully enclosed cabinet for enhanced safety, preventing direct exposure to the laser beam during operation.

Usage Features

The LS1390 is designed for ease of use by authorized and trained operators. Before operation, users must ensure that no objects are located inside the bed that could obstruct the machine's mechanics. The system requires specific environmental conditions for optimal performance, including a temperature range of 0-35°C and humidity not exceeding 70%. Locations with high temperatures, dust, poor air circulation, or mechanical shocks should be avoided.

To start the machine, the mains supply is switched ON/OFF using a dedicated switch. For correct start-up, several conditions must be met: unrestricted freedom of motion of the mechanics, no materials under the working table, and all doors and cabinets must be shut. Immediately after being switched on, the machine initiates referencing processes. Once these processes are complete, the machine indicates its readiness for use on the computer.

The LS1390 is controlled via Cypcut software, which is provided on a CD along with the printer driver and an operation manual. Computer connection is established via USB. The machine's bed size is 1300x900, accommodating a variety of material sizes. It's important to note that this machine is specifically designed for cutting metal substrates and cannot cut materials such as wood and plastics.

Safety is paramount during usage. Operators are warned against starting the machine without water in the chiller tank, as dry running for more than 5 seconds can damage the pump seal and lead to water leakage. Safety stickers on the machine indicate potential risks, including laser beam hazards, fire risks, and the danger of electrocution from 240V components inside the isolator cabinet. Users are advised not to open the isolator cabinet when the machine is switched on and to contact HPC Laser for any retooling or workplace changes. Laser safety goggles are available for purchase from HPC Laser and are recommended for protection.

Maintenance Features

Regular maintenance is crucial for ensuring the optimal performance and longevity of the LS1390. The user manual emphasizes the importance of keeping the system clean to prevent dust accumulation, which can affect performance and increase fire hazards.

General Cleaning:

  • Cleaning and maintenance work should only be performed when the machine is fully switched off and unplugged from the mains supply.
  • The laser head should be moved to an easily accessible position to facilitate cleaning of the work area.
  • Operators should check for dust accumulation in the laser system at least once a day. The cleaning interval depends heavily on the type of metal being processed.
  • The system must be kept clean at all times, as flammable particles in the working area increase the fire hazard.

Safety during Maintenance:

  • Any use of controls, adjustments, or procedures other than those specified in the manual may result in hazardous laser radiation exposure.
  • NEVER attempt to modify or disassemble the laser. Do not try to start a system that has been modified or disassembled.
  • Repair work and maintenance in areas with electrical voltage must be done with extreme care, strictly observing safety instructions regarding electricity.

The manual also advises keeping the original packaging in case the machine needs to be relocated or shipped for any reason. For any technical problems or queries, users are directed to contact HPC Laser's support or sales teams.
